Question: How often do you think that people would try to take advantage of you if they got the chance, and how often would they try to be fair?
Choices: "Try to take advantage almost all of the time" "Try to take advantage most of the time" "Try to be fair most of the time" "Try to be fair almost all of the time"
Data: % of "Try to be fair most of the time" "Try to be fair almost all of the time"
Period:
Area:
8 countries/ areas
Highlight:
1 Germany80.1%
2 Sweden 73.0%
3 Japan72.6%
4 Australia71.5%
4 France71.5%
6 United Kingdom66.3%
7 Republic of Korea64.7%
8 United States59.4%

Note
Can't choose/ No answer are excluded.

No data for 2 countries.

Source
ISSP 2014
